Community Services Advocate

Date: 02/06/2026

Program: Community Services- CSBG/LIHEAP

Job Title: Community Services Advocate

Location: Cocke County NSC

FLSA Status: Non-Exempt, Full-time; 37.5 hours per week

Salary Grade: 13 (13.83 per hour)

Reports to: NSC Manager


POSITION SUMMARY: Serves as a liaison for low-income residents and the NSC, providing service information and referrals.


D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ES / 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:


• Learns all aspects of the services offered at the Neighborhood Service Center, including CSBG services, LIHEAP, the Assurance 16 Initiative, and vendor-funded assistance programs.

• Greets clients and visitors, assesses needs and provides referrals or assistance accordingly.

• Assesses clients’ needs and refers or assists accordingly.

• Receives client applications, ensures all documentation is correct according to guidelines and procedures.

• Maintains up-to-date client records as required and assists with all services, as needed, at the NSC.

• Maintains adequate supplies of all NSC program applications and forms.

• Maintains inventory records and supplier information for Necessity Closet items and restock as needed.

• Assists the NSC Manager with all functions at the NSC, including preparation for, maintenance of, and servicing of LIHEAP intakes.

• Performs other duties as assigned.
